A friend lost his sister to these scumbags. She was one of many M&MIW in Canada. 
These highways exist all over the world. In lots of cases, it's not the highways 
that are the problem.It's the lack of affordable infrastructure that causes the issues. 
People need to move from one location to another. If there is no affordable 
transportation, people will still move by hitchhiking or other sketchy means. 
Unfortunately, there are predators that take advantage of this.
